@Tiffany I have got to ask because my curiosity is getting the better of me -
What is a “comi-convention” ?

2 Likes

It’s like a fair with people selling items to do with comics, film or TV. People also dress up as their favourite characters from the comics, films or TV. They have competitions for the best. Lots of things to do & photo shoot opatunities, plus all the stalls selling items. It’s great fun to do but hard work.
